Lahore: A resurgent South African team best Pakistan on Saturday by 6 wickets in the second T20 match of the series.

Chasing a paltry target of 145, South Africa reached the target with relative ease despite early loss of wickets. Pite Van Biljon and Reeza Hendricks scored 42 each to guide their team to victory in just 16.2 overs.
The tourists excelled with the bat and the ball, with fast bowler Dwaine Pretorius taking a five wicket haul earlier in the day to restrict Pakistan to just 144 runs.
Mohammad Rizwan was the top scorer for the hosts, scoring 51 runs to take the team to a decent total after the fall of quick wickets during Pakistan's innings.
The series now stands at 1-1, Pakistan having won the first match by 3 runs in a thriller on Thursday.
The final match of the series will also be played in Lahore on Sunday.
